Eliminate T1 leased lines for reduced operating expenses.
Supports legacy PBX, including proprietary features and signaling.
Protects investment in legacy equipment.
Carrier grade voice quality.
Configurable delay vs. bandwidth trade-off.
Fully redundant hardware, including all system and service modules.
Management via SNMP, Telnet or web terminal.
Available with voice compression modules.
Quick ROI! Equipment for a single T1 link starts at roughly $1,500.
Interoperable with lower capacity TDM over IP gateways; IPmux-11 (1 x T1), IPmux-14 (4 x T1s), IPmux-8 (8 x T1s) or the IPmux-16 (16 x T1s or 2 x T3s).
